KARACHI: At least six children were injured when a school van caught fire in the Nazimabad area of Karachi on Monday morning. According to rescue officials, the fire erupted after the vehicle overheated, engulfing the van while it was transporting students. Gaza: Unexploded bombs left behind after months of Israeli bombardment are claiming more lives in Gaza, as recovery and search operations continue amid widespread destruction. According to local authorities, at least 53 Palestinians have been killed and hundreds injured by unexploded ordnance (UXO) since residents began returning to their neighborhoods.
